Professor William R. Cook has taught thousands of students over the course of more than 35 years at the State University of New York at Geneseo, where he is Distinguished Teaching Professor of History. Professor Cook is an expert in medieval history, the Renaissance and Reformation periods and the Bible and Christian thought. The Medieval Academy of America awarded Professor Cook the CARA Award of Excellence in the Teaching of Medieval Studies for his achievements.
